Save Me a Place


Save me a place by your side,
entrapped in your thoughts.
I want to drink the color of your eyes
as I search the path to your heart.

I want to dip my fingers in your beauty
and sketch a portrait of shadows,
intermingled with light, intricately
floating on your love like a phantom.

You’re like a glimmering moonstone,
kissed by golden sunlight,
bedazzled by your skin tone,
as I inhale your caramel thighs.

I hear the sound of your footsteps
echoing through my mind.
Our lips touch in the perfect kiss,
sealed within these poetic lines.
